夏日炎炎,户外活动总是让人感到燥热难耐。在这个时候,喝水解暑不仅能够帮助我们恢复体力,还能成为摄影中一道美丽的风景线。今天,就让我们一起探索如何捕捉到喝水解暑的清爽瞬间,用镜头记录下这美好的时光。
一、选择合适的拍摄时机
1. 早晨和傍晚
早晨和傍晚的光线柔和,色彩丰富,是拍摄的好时机。此时,阳光不会过于强烈,可以更好地展现人物的表情和喝水时的清爽感。
2. 雨后
雨后的空气清新,景物更加生动。此时拍摄,可以捕捉到喝水时水珠在阳光下的闪耀,增加照片的趣味性。
二、构图技巧
1. 利用前景
在拍摄喝水解暑的场景时,可以利用前景增加照片的层次感。例如,将一杯水放在前景,人物在背景喝水,形成一种视觉上的对比。
2. 对比构图
通过对比构图,可以突出喝水解暑的主题。例如,将人物与周围的环境形成对比,如将人物置于烈日下,喝水时的清爽感更加明显。
3. 利用线条
线条在摄影中具有引导视线的作用。在拍摄喝水解暑的场景时,可以利用线条引导观众的视线,如地面的小径、水杯的边缘等。
三、拍摄技巧
1. 慢速快门
使用慢速快门可以捕捉到水珠在阳光下的流动轨迹,增加照片的动感。
import cv2
import numpy as np
# 读取视频
cap = cv2.VideoCapture(0)
while True:
ret, frame = cap.read()
if not ret:
break
# 转换为灰度图像
gray = cv2.cvtColor(frame, cv2.COLOR_BGR2GRAY)
# 高斯模糊
blur = cv2.GaussianBlur(gray, (5, 5), 0)
# Canny边缘检测
edges = cv2.Canny(blur, 50, 150)
# 查找轮廓
contours, _ = cv2.findContours(edges, cv2.RETR_EXTERNAL, cv2.CHAIN_APPROX_SIMPLE)
# 遍历轮廓
for contour in contours:
# 计算轮廓的面积
area = cv2.contourArea(contour)
if area > 100:
# 获取轮廓的边界框
x, y, w, h = cv2.boundingRect(contour)
# 在原图上绘制边界框
cv2.rectangle(frame, (x, y), (x + w, y + h), (0, 255, 0), 2)
# 显示图像
cv2.imshow('Frame', frame)
# 按 'q' 键退出
if cv2.waitKey(1) & 0xFF == ord('q'):
break
# 释放视频捕捉对象
cap.release()
# 关闭所有窗口
cv2.destroyAllWindows()
2. 利用光线
光线是摄影的灵魂。在拍摄喝水解暑的场景时,可以利用光线突出主题,如逆光、侧光等。
四、后期处理
1. 调整曝光
在后期处理中,可以适当调整曝光,使照片更加明亮。
2. 调整色彩
根据拍摄场景和主题,可以适当调整色彩,如增加饱和度、对比度等。
3. 添加滤镜
为照片添加滤镜,可以增加照片的艺术感。
夏日户外,喝水解暑的清爽瞬间值得被记录。通过以上技巧,相信你一定能够捕捉到美好的瞬间,用镜头记录下这个美好的季节。
